This is easy & tasty dosa which doesn't require any grinding & fermentation process and can be done very quickly with less ingredients. For Batter: | |
1/2 cup | Semolina, (Rava) |
1/2 cup | Rice flour |
1/4 cup | All purpose flour, Maida |
2 cups | Water |
Salt, to taste | |
For Seasoning: | |
1 tbsp | Oil |
1 tsp | Mustard seed |
1 | chopped Onion |
2-3 | (Minced) Green chili |
Ginger, as required (Minced) | |
1tsp | Black Pepper, Crushed or whole |
1tsp | Cumin |
Jeera | |
Cashew, as required (optional) | |
Curry leaves, as required |
Mix all Batter Ingredients & keep it aside for minimum 30 minutes.
Batter should be very thin i.e watery & flowing than the normal dosa batter.
Heat Oil in a pan and add mustard seeds, when its splutter add remaining seasoning ingredients & saute it for few
minutes until Onion turns to transparent.
Add this to rava mixture & mix well.
Adjust Salt to taste.
Heat the tawa to sizzling hot & pour ladle full of batter rapidly from outwards edge of griddle to center in a circular
motion. We cant spread the batter as we do for normal dosa.
Drizzle some oil over the edges of the dosa & flip to other side when it turns golden brown color.
Serve Hot with Spicy chutney & sambar.
Note: If your dosa is not crispy enough then add extra tbsp of rice flour. Before making each dosa, mix
the batter well & if batter becomes thick after making few dosas then add little water to it.
You may also use one Egg instead of All purpose flour & follow the same procedure, Just beat and add to
the batter & mix well.
